IAH (Irish Group) run an annual conference, meetings and seminars.  “Technical Discussion” meetings are held in the Geological Survey of Ireland, Beggars Bush, Haddington Road, Dublin 4.

Coffee at 17:30 (look closely for the chocolate coated biscuits!!), lecture at 18:00 (except some joint meetings with the IEI which are indicated otherwise). 

 

Click on the link to view or download the associated report (pdf format).   Abstracts for conference proceedings are also included, a full copy of proceedings may be purchased from the Conference Secretary.
